Our company provides integrated support from server selection and procurement to initial setup and administrator training, supporting the company's business DX promotion. ■ Background of Implementation First Kitchen urgently needed to replace its groupware system due to the announcement of the end of support for its current system. The previous system suffered from issues such as the inability to upload files due to server capacity limitations. Furthermore, the analog operation of application and reporting tasks, primarily using paper and spreadsheets, required a significant amount of time for aggregation work at the headquarters. A robust information infrastructure was required to resolve these issues and contribute to the efficiency of operations for both stores and headquarters. ■ Deciding Factors for Selecting 'desknet's NEO' With the groupware replacement as an opportunity, First Kitchen selected desknet's NEO primarily based on the following five points: 1. Complete Coverage of Existing Functions All essential functions used in the previous system, such as bulletin boards, file sharing, schedule management, facility reservations, workflows, and simple applications, are standard features, enabling a smooth transition. 2. Intuitive Operability An interface that allows on-site store staff to use it without hesitation, regardless of their IT literacy.
